Transaction 8808d0043619e26b34ab6e40e67885107cf41bcaa30faa65f2f63396351edc03
1 Input
1 Output
-
8808d0043619e26b34ab6e40e67885107cf41bcaa30faa65f2f63396351edc03:0
- value
- 317326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e12358f9ea231724cfcde673ffd074cb0ebbd70d OP_EQUAL
- address
- 3NDSJhQApbLKTxbcr7osnWYrKdxDzZfbYE